A highlight of summer festivals in Japan is the bon-odori (盆踊り/ Bon dance). Each region in Japan has their own version of the dance, as well as different music. In Japanese Buddhist tradition, dancing is a way to welcome the spirits of our ancestors and the celebrate life. Dancers circle the yagura, a high wooden bandstand for the musicians and singers.

Come to learn the dance, see people dressed in yukata, and experience the sound and feel of taiko drums.
